Output 435599ee0236b17033ffe2e6172dc6a63ffa8d6ae5d16e34003c2d079463076d:5

value
178854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a55f24887a0179c5373e762340102e15e05afa24 OP_EQUAL
address
3GmRPpvDPMtpkidmWKacQV4r9oVCLyGHjP
transaction
435599ee0236b17033ffe2e6172dc6a63ffa8d6ae5d16e34003c2d079463076d
confirmations
126794
spent
true